РАБОТА c Database Desktop. Маски ввода данных в DATABASE DESKTOP

Страницы работы

Содержание работы

РАБОТА c   Database Desktop

1.  Маски ввода данных в DATABASE DESKTOP

При определении свойств полей таблицы можно задать: наименьшее допустимое значение; наибольшее значение; значение, принимаемое по умолчанию.

Можно задать также маску (условие) ввода данных, которая позволяет исключить ошибки ввода. В маске используются определённые знаки, значение который приведено в таблице.

Знак

Смысл

 

#

Цифра

 

?

Любая буква (в любом регистре)

 

&

Любая буква (преобразуется в верхний регистр)

~

Любая буква (преобразуется в нижний регистр)

@

Любой символ

!

Любой символ (преобразуется в верхний регистр)

*

определяет число последующих вводимых символов   

(*3{#} -означает, что следует ввести 3 цифры) или любое количество символов определённого типа

(*# - означает, что можно ввести любое целое число)

[abc]

возможен ввод abc, причём после ввода а символы bc впишутся сами

{a,b,c}

возможен ввод a, b, или c

2. Поля подсматривания из другой таблицы

Для ускорения и исключения ошибок ввода данных, представляющих ограниченный фиксированный набор элементов, который можно взять из другой таблицы, можно использовать настройку «подсматривания» (Table Lookup).

Допустим, есть таблица с названиями улиц. Мы создаём таблицу  телефонов, в которой указываются адреса номеров. Для текущего поля Улица выберите свойство Table Lookup и нажмите кнопку Define (определить). Появится окно, в котором с помощью кнопки Browse…

найдите таблицу с улицами и нажмите кнопку

со стрелкой влево.

Замечание: поле Street в «подсматриваемой» таблице Улицы  должно быть ключевым, а формат поля должен быть одинаковым в обеих таблицах.

После создания таблицы, откройте её (File \ Open \ Table), выберите редактирование (Table \ Edit Data). Теперь если в поле Улица нажать комбинацию клавиш Ctrl пробел (подсказка об этом появляется в статусной строке) появится окно с таблицей Улицы, из которой можно выбрать требуемую улицу.

Похожие материалы

Информация о работе